WebGraphemes = Sound Letter Patterns . English can be thought of as an alphabetic language consisting of 44 speech sounds (phonemes) which map onto letter patterns (graphemes). We have 20 vowel sounds, and 24 consonant sounds. In English we use graphemes to represent these various sounds (phonemes).
